Task
Where is Australia? Who lives there and what languages do they speak? What animals are there? Are there deserts, forests, beaches, mountains, rivers...?
Well, you will discover the answers with "Discovering Australia"
At the end, with all your new knowledge about Australia, you will create a Power point presentation for the English week, explaining your discoveries about this amazing country.
Remember that you are going to present your PPT to your 3rd grade schoolmates. Be creative and have fun!
